Massage Guns: Your At-Home Solution for Muscle Relief

A massage gun is a handheld, battery-powered device designed to deliver targeted percussive therapy to your muscles. Unlike traditional vibrating massagers, a massage gun utilizes rapid, repetitive pulses of pressure to penetrate deep into muscle tissue. This action, often described as a “mini hammer” effect, stimulates blood flow and helps to release tension. The technology essentially mimics the deep tissue massage techniques used by physical therapists and massage professionals, making it an accessible tool for self-care.

The core principle behind a massage gun’s effectiveness lies in its ability to influence both muscle tissue and fascia, the connective tissue surrounding muscles and bones. By rapidly impacting these areas, the device helps to increase circulation, warm up muscle tissue, and promote the release of metabolic waste products. While percussive therapy has roots in ancient practices, modern massage guns have emerged in recent years as a popular and effective tool in sports recovery, physical therapy, and general wellness.

Unlocking the Amazing Benefits of a Massage Gun

Integrating a massage gun into your routine can offer a multitude of advantages, significantly enhancing your physical recovery and comfort. These powerful devices are more than just a passing trend; they are backed by the experiences of countless users and insights from fitness and medical professionals.

One of the most celebrated benefits is the reduction of muscle soreness following strenuous activities or workouts. Massage guns help alleviate delayed-onset muscle soreness (DOMS) by increasing blood flow to the affected areas and reducing inflammation. This rapid pressure helps to flush out toxins and bring essential nutrients to fatigued muscles, facilitating quicker repair and regeneration.

Beyond soreness, massage guns are excellent for increasing blood circulation and lymphatic flow. The percussive action drives blood into tight areas, which improves oxygen and nutrient delivery to muscle cells while also stimulating the lymphatic system to remove waste products. This enhanced circulation is crucial for overall muscle health and efficient recovery.

Regular use of a massage gun can also improve your flexibility and range of motion. By loosening tight muscles and fascia, the device helps to restore muscle elasticity and joint mobility. This can be particularly beneficial for individuals looking to enhance their athletic performance or simply improve daily movement and posture.

Many users find that massage guns contribute to stress reduction and improved sleep quality. The deep tissue stimulation can have a relaxing effect on the nervous system, easing overall tension and promoting a sense of calm. This relaxation can, in turn, lead to more restful sleep, which is vital for both physical and mental recovery.

While research on athletic performance is mixed, some studies suggest that massage guns may temporarily enhance muscle strength and flexibility, particularly before a single, intense event. They can also serve as an effective tool for injury prevention by warming up muscles and increasing their pliability before exercise, thereby reducing the risk of strains and tears. Additionally, there is potential for massage guns to aid in breaking up scar tissue, contributing to smoother and more flexible tissue recovery after injury.

These are the most common type, offering a good balance of power, features, and portability for general use. They typically have an L-shaped design, are moderate in size and weight, and come with a variety of attachments and speed settings. Standard handheld models are versatile and suitable for a wide range of users, from casual fitness enthusiasts to those seeking daily relief from muscle tension.

Mini Massage Guns

Designed for ultimate portability, mini massage guns are compact, lightweight, and often quieter than their larger counterparts. Their smaller size makes them ideal for travel, gym bags, or discreet use at the office. While generally less powerful than full-sized or professional models, they can still deliver effective relief for smaller muscle groups and lighter tension. They are perfect for on-the-go recovery and individuals who prioritize ease of transport.

Professional/Deep Tissue Massage Guns

These devices are built for maximum power, amplitude, and stall force, making them suitable for serious athletes, bodybuilders, or individuals with persistent deep muscle knots. They often feature robust motors, extended battery life, and more advanced settings. Professional-grade massage guns tend to be larger and heavier, sometimes with ergonomic designs like triangular handles to improve reach and leverage for intense, targeted treatments.

Percussion vs. Vibration Massage Guns

It’s important to clarify the distinction between “percussion” and “vibration” in this context. While some devices might primarily vibrate, true massage guns deliver percussive therapy. Percussion involves a more direct, deeper impact into the muscle, effectively “hammering” the tissue. Vibration therapy, while also beneficial, tends to act more on the superficial layers. Most modern massage guns utilize percussion as their primary mechanism, often with adjustable settings that can feel more vibratory at lower intensities.

Decoding Massage Gun Specifications: A Buyer’s Guide

Choosing the best massage gun can feel overwhelming with the array of options available. To make an informed decision, consider these crucial specifications and features:

1. Amplitude (Stroke Length)

Amplitude refers to how deep the massage gun head travels into the muscle with each percussion, typically measured in millimeters (mm).

  • Lower amplitude (6-10mm): Provides a gentler, more vibrational massage, good for sensitive areas or light warm-ups.
  • Higher amplitude (12-16mm+): Delivers a deeper, more intense massage, ideal for deep tissue work, breaking up knots, and targeting larger muscle groups.

2. Stall Force

Stall force indicates how much pressure you can apply to the massage gun before its motor stalls or stops. Measured in pounds (lbs), a higher stall force means the device can withstand more downward pressure without losing effectiveness, allowing for a deeper massage.

  • Lower stall force (20-30 lbs): Common in mini or budget models, suitable for general relaxation.
  • Higher stall force (40-60+ lbs): Found in more powerful and professional-grade units, essential for deep tissue penetration on dense muscles.

3. Percussions Per Minute (PPM) / Speed Settings

PPM, also known as RPM (rotations per minute), measures how many times the massage head strikes the muscle per minute. Most massage guns offer multiple speed settings, allowing you to customize the intensity.

  • Range: Typically falls between 1,200 to 3,200 PPM.
  • Variable Speeds: A wider range of speeds (e.g., 3-5+ settings) offers greater versatility for different muscle groups and treatment needs. Start low and gradually increase.

4. Attachments (Massage Heads)

Most massage guns come with interchangeable attachments, each designed for specific purposes:

  • Round/Ball: Versatile for large and medium muscle groups (quads, glutes, hamstrings).
  • Flat: Good for general full-body massage, dense muscles, and areas like the IT band.
  • Bullet/Cone: Targets specific trigger points, knots, and smaller areas (feet, hands).
  • Fork/Spine: Designed to glide along either side of the spine or target Achilles tendons.
  • Heated/Cold: Some advanced models offer attachments with thermal therapy for added benefits.

5. Battery Life

A good battery life is essential for convenience, especially if you plan to use your massage gun on the go or for multiple sessions without recharging. Look for devices offering at least 2-3 hours of continuous use; many premium models provide 4-8 hours.

6. Noise Level

The motor’s noise level can significantly impact your experience. Quieter models (often using brushless motors, typically below 60 dB) are preferable, allowing for use in various environments without disturbance. Many top-tier guns are surprisingly quiet even at higher settings.

7. Ergonomics and Weight

Consider how the massage gun feels in your hand. An ergonomic design, such as an L-shaped or triangular handle, makes it easier to grip and reach different parts of your body, including your back, without strain. The weight of the device (typically 1-3 lbs) also plays a role in how comfortable it is to use for extended periods.

8. Price vs. Value

Massage guns range widely in price. While budget options can be a good starting point, investing in a mid-range or premium model often means better durability, more powerful motors, longer battery life, and superior overall performance. Balance your budget with your specific needs and desired features.

How to Use a Massage Gun for Maximum Effectiveness

Using your massage gun correctly is paramount to achieving the best results and preventing injury. Here’s a step-by-step guide to safe and effective percussive therapy:

1. Warm Up Your Muscles

Before you begin, it’s a good idea to lightly warm up the muscle group you plan to massage. This could be through a few minutes of light cardio or dynamic stretching. This helps prepare the tissue for the deeper percussion.

2. Choose the Right Attachment

Select a massage head appropriate for the muscle group you’re targeting. Use larger, rounder heads for broad muscles and bullet or flat heads for more precise, deeper work on knots.

3. Turn It On First

Always turn the massage gun on before placing it on your body. This prevents a jarring start and allows you to control the initial contact. Start on the lowest speed setting to assess your tolerance.

4. Glide, Don’t Press

Hold the massage gun perpendicular to the muscle surface. Let the gun’s percussive action do the work; you don’t need to apply excessive pressure. Gently glide the device slowly and steadily along the muscle fibers, moving with the length of the muscle. If you encounter a knot, you can pause on it for a few seconds, but avoid digging in too aggressively.

5. Mind Your Time

Limit your massage to 1-2 minutes per muscle group for general warm-up or cool-down. For persistent knots or stiffness, you can spend up to 2-3 minutes on a specific area. Avoid prolonged use on a single spot, as this can lead to bruising or tissue damage.

6. Breathe and Relax

Remember to breathe deeply and relax the muscle you are working on. Tensing up will counteract the benefits of the massage.

7. Hydrate Post-Massage

After your session, drink plenty of water. This helps your body flush out toxins released during the massage and supports muscle recovery.

Important Safety Considerations and Precautions

While massage guns offer significant benefits, improper use can lead to injury. Always prioritize safety and listen to your body.

Areas to Absolutely Avoid:

  • Bony areas and joints: Never use a massage gun directly on bones, joints, or bony prominences (e.g., knees, elbows, ankles, spine, chest, rib cage). This can irritate tendons and bursa sacs.
  • The Neck: Be extremely cautious, especially on the front of the neck, where major arteries, nerves, and veins are located. Stick to the upper trapezius (shoulders) if you must, but avoid the neck area entirely.
  • Open wounds, bruises, rashes, or inflamed skin: Never use the device on compromised skin.
  • New scars: Avoid fresh scars (less than 12 weeks old).
  • Varicose veins: Do not use on areas with varicose veins.
  • Groin area: Avoid this sensitive region to prevent injury.
  • Areas with reduced sensation: If you have neuropathy or numbness, avoid using a massage gun as you may not feel if you are causing damage.

Consult a Healthcare Professional If You Have:

  • Chronic medical conditions: Such as diabetes, blood clotting disorders, kidney disease, or iron deficiency.
  • Heart conditions or are on blood thinners.
  • Pregnancy.
  • Acute muscle strains or tears: Especially within the first 3-5 days after injury.
  • Fractures or areas of low bone density (osteoporosis).
  • Active inflammation or recent joint replacements.

Always stop immediately if you feel pain or discomfort. A massage gun should provide relief, not intensify pain. If in doubt, consult a physical therapist or doctor for personalized advice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main differences between a percussive massage gun and a vibrating massager?

Percussive massage guns deliver rapid, targeted impacts deep into muscle tissue, aiming to penetrate deeper than typical vibrating massagers. This percussive action is more effective at breaking up knots, increasing blood flow, and easing deep muscle tension compared to the more superficial effects of simple vibration.

How often should I use a massage gun?

For general warm-up or cool-down, 30 seconds to 1 minute per muscle group is usually sufficient. For persistent muscle soreness or stiffness, you can use a massage gun for 2-3 minutes per muscle group, up to 2-3 times a day. Always listen to your body and avoid overusing it on any single area.

Can massage guns help with cellulite?

While massage guns can improve circulation and lymphatic drainage, which may temporarily improve skin appearance, there is no scientific evidence to suggest they can permanently eliminate cellulite. Their primary benefits are muscle recovery and pain relief.

Is a more expensive massage gun always better?

Not necessarily, but higher-priced massage guns often come with more powerful motors (higher stall force and amplitude), longer battery life, quieter operation, and more advanced features like smart app connectivity or specialized attachments. The “best” depends on your specific needs, budget, and desired intensity.

Can I use a massage gun if I have a medical condition?

It is crucial to consult your doctor or physical therapist before using a massage gun if you have any pre-existing medical conditions, such as heart disease, blood clots, neuropathy, or if you are pregnant. Certain conditions or areas of the body should be strictly avoided to prevent injury.
